About the Role
We’re seeking a CERTLOC Certified Utility Locator to join our growing operations team based at either Burton or Lonsdale South Australia. This field-based role involves locating underground utility services using advanced technologies such as Ground Penetrating Radar (GPR) and Electromagnetic Induction (EMI).
You’ll play a key role in supporting infrastructure projects, ensuring accurate data collection, and maintaining high safety and quality standards.
Key Responsibilities
Locate underground assets using GPR and EMI
Interpret utility maps, DBYD plans, and aerial imagery
Submit detailed utility reports upon job completion
Manage permit requests and client documentation
Train team members on asset location tools
Maintain and troubleshoot locating equipment
